This event will celebrate Mark Novak's recent publication: Phenomenologies of Incarnation in Michel Henry and Emmanuel Falque: Saving Flesh, Redeeming Body.
Mark is an instructor in the Departments of Humanities and General Education. The book looks at how two contemporary French Catholic phenomenologists talk about embodiment in relation to flesh and body, especially in relation to Christian theology. Mark will give some introductory remarks, and then there will be two respondents to the book.
